decreasing delay between block and being sure all users in block is got

This commit is contained in:
erqan 2016-11-24 18:10:26 +03:00
parent 4637c68df7
commit 46d6264743

View File

@ -517,7 +517,7 @@ NewUserSearch.prototype = {
setTimeout(function () { setTimeout(function () {
requestBlock(block.previousblockhash, NewUserSearch.processBlockUsersProxy, {obj: args.obj, args: args.args}); requestBlock(block.previousblockhash, NewUserSearch.processBlockUsersProxy, {obj: args.obj, args: args.args});
}, 100); }, 10);
} else { } else {
NewUserSearch.isNewUserThRunning = false; NewUserSearch.isNewUserThRunning = false;
@ -527,14 +527,15 @@ NewUserSearch.prototype = {
for (var i = 0; i < block.usernames.length; i++) { for (var i = 0; i < block.usernames.length; i++) {
if (NewUserSearch.knownNewUsers.indexOf(block.usernames[i]) == -1) { if (NewUserSearch.knownNewUsers.indexOf(block.usernames[i]) == -1) {
processWhoToFollowSuggestion(args.args.module, block.usernames[i], undefined, args.args.prepend); processWhoToFollowSuggestion(args.args.module, block.usernames[i], undefined, args.args.prepend);
if (args.args.prepend)
NewUserSearch.knownNewUsers.unshift(block.usernames[i]);
else
NewUserSearch.knownNewUsers.push(block.usernames[i]);
if (!args.args.live && NewUserSearch.knownNewUsers.length >= args.args.n + args.args.offset) if (!args.args.live && NewUserSearch.knownNewUsers.length >= args.args.n + args.args.offset)
break; break;
} }
} }
if (args.args.prepend)
NewUserSearch.knownNewUsers.unshift(block.usernames);
else
NewUserSearch.knownNewUsers.push(block.usernames);
this.save(); this.save();
} }
}; };